Hello,

We have been using the EA 12.1 and the HTML repost generation facility in the API. Problem is that the user running the report must be logged in. This is a security problem on the server because the policy is to log off users after 5 days.
The feature we want is to document in Confluence - which we have been using for years.
We have licenses for EA 13 and looking into Jommla. Jommla is a little tricky becaus we use the model GUID in Confluence.

So it is either:
1. Anyone got EA 13 to run in a Windows Service context?
2. Is Joomla export exporting like HTML reporting but can run as a Windows Service. I would very much like to keep the URI address so we don't have to change all our links if we take on Joomla.

Any experience or input would be greatly appreaciated,
